The Role of Interferon-gamma Release Assay in Tuberculosis Control

Abstract: The Role of Interferon-gamma Release Assay in Tuberculosis ControlTuberculosis is still one of the major global public health threats. Countries with low incidence must focus on exhausting the reservoir of future cases by preventing reactivation. Therefore, it is important to identify and effectively treat those individuals who have latent tuberculosis infection and who may develop active disease. “…This polymorphism is located in the promoter region of the CD14 gene [ 9 ], and the T allele seems to act as a negative regulator of in vitro T-cell proliferation and decreased production of cytokines, including interferon-y (IFN-γ) [ 28 ]. IFN-γ is an essential cytokine for the control of mycobacterial infection [ 39 ], and therefore, rs2569190 may produce an environment that favors development of TB. Interestingly, other studies found this SNP associated with ischemic stroke [ 40 ], cardiovascular disease [ 41 ], and asthma [ 42 ], indicating that these polymorphisms could actually lead to a more profound alteration in immune responses that may affect a large number of clinical conditions.…”
